The easiest alternative to applying weed and feed is to treat feeding and weed killing as two separate processes. Apply fertilizer at the time dictated by the kind of grass growing in your yard —fall for cool-season grasses, late spring or early summer for warm-season grasses. Bermuda will bolt into action in the spring when soil temperatures are over 65 degrees. This will also be the optimal time for spring seeding. Bermuda seed can be planted up to about 6-8 weeks before the Fall’s first frost. Bermuda is moderate to slow to fully establish, so planting earlier in the season is best.Apply broadleaf herbicide in the early summer after the grass is fully greened up but before daytime temperatures get over 90 degrees. Most turfgrasses are difficult to control within another turfgrass. Therefore, turf managers should select clean seed or vegetative sources for establishment, use an adapted turfgrass species and cultivar for their location, and use proper mowing and fertilization techniques to maintain a dense, actively growing, desired turf. Fortunat...Fertilize your Bermuda lawn every four to six weeks during the growing season. Spread the fertilizer in the morning before the hot afternoon heat to reduce the risk of burning the grass with nitrogen. Nitrogen consists of salts, which dehydrate the grass when applied during hot or no water temperatures. In April, water your Bermuda grass deeply and infrequently (1 inch of water per week). Avoid overwatering, which can lead to shallow roots and increased susceptibility to pests and diseases.
